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 14 and 9 is 126
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 126 - For the 1st fraction, since 14 × 9 = 126,
21/14 = 21 × 9/14 × 9 = 189/126 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 9 × 14 = 126,
8/9 = 8 × 14/9 × 14 = 112/126 - Add the two like fractions:
189/126 + 112/126 = 189 + 112/126 = 301/126 - 301/126 simplified gives 43/18
- So, 21/14 + 8/9 = 43/18
